## TKT-208: Bounce processor needs sign-off before Friday

Hey team — quick one. The Pelicanpost bounce processor is getting a rework so hard bounces suppress addresses immediately instead of after three strikes. Soft bounces keep the old retry ladder. Why you care: customers will see suppression happen faster, so expect a few "why did my contact get blocked" tickets the first week. There's a canned reply drafted in the macros folder. We can't ship until someone signs off on the suppression rules. The sign-off owner is named below.

account owner for bawip-tahag: Raleth Quenok

## Changelog — Staticloom 2.8

Changed default rebuild mode from full to incremental. Previously every content change triggered a complete site rebuild; Staticloom now hashes page dependencies and rebuilds only affected routes. Full rebuilds still run nightly and can be forced with the existing CLI flag. Maintainers upgrading older deployments should note the cache directory must be writable and persistent. The new defaults shipped with this release are listed below.

config for kafof-bawef:
holath:
  log_level: debug
  metrics_host: metrics.holath.qorvelsys.internal
  pin: 2191
  pool_size: 32

## Deployment

The Relume export-retry worker ships as a single container alongside the main API. It scans the dead-letter table every cycle, re-enqueues failed exports with exponential backoff, and gives up after the configured attempt limit. Deploy it with exactly one replica; concurrent scanners will double-submit. Before rolling a new version, confirm the retry settings match the values below.

deployment values, yagaf-yahig:
[ralion]
team = silok
access_code = ac_e16f3a
owner = aldvan.ulaion
host = ralion.qorvelgrid.corp
port = 9200
peer = ulamir.ferracorp.test
salt = 258b1b36
pin = 3673